Four options, the first two already mentioned.

1) Credits counted and not counted.

2) Time compression, in the past some movies were sped up slightly to fit on 120min tapes, I believe some of the Superman movies are examples of this. Obviously 121 and 122 minute films wouldn't fit on a 120min tape.

3) One of the copies is NTSC format , the other PAL. PAL tapes were always 4% faster than the film as it is one frame a second faster. If you include rounding in the calculations then that would work with your two runtimes.

4) The box is just wrong, someone typed in the wrong movies runtime.
